# EchoDocent audio-guide app — environment file for the Marwick Gallery deployment.
# Support team: this file controls the tour-sync backend that the handheld units
# poll every 30 seconds. Changing the language pack path requires a device restart,
# but everything else hot-reloads. If visitors report silent exhibits, check the
# stream host setting first before escalating to the Harrowfen office. The playback
# service also authenticates against the content vault, and its credential goes on
# the very next line below this comment block.

env line for fafof-fahag: LEDGER_TOKEN5=f8790

Quick notes from Tuesday's sync, mostly for the new folks. The PDF invoice renderer (internally "InkPress") had font-embedding hiccups again — totals were rendering in fallback glyphs for invoices over two pages. We agreed to pin the font bundle version and add a render snapshot test before the Quillford release. If you touch the layout engine, please read the margins doc first. Questions about any of this go to our renderer lead:

named custodian: Belius Casath Ulaix Sorius

Handover: timezone handling in report exports

Hey folks — quick brain dump before I'm out. Exports from Quillstone currently render timestamps in the account's home timezone, but scheduled reports were silently falling back to UTC when the account had no locale set. I patched the fallback to use the workspace default instead, and added a warning log when that happens. Nightly jobs for the Bramfield tenant are the ones to watch. The export worker picks up its timezone behavior from the following settings.

deployment values, faduf-tawep:
SORDOR_LOG_LEVEL=error
SORDOR_METRICS_HOST=metrics.sordor.nelvrolabs.internal
SORDOR_POOL_SIZE=4

The garage occupancy feed for the Brindlewood campus arrives over a message queue every thirty seconds, one record per level, published by the Stallgrid edge boxes. Counts can briefly go negative when a sensor double-fires on exit; the ingest job clamps these to zero and flags the interval. If the feed stalls for more than five minutes, the dashboard falls back to the last known snapshot. Sensor mappings, queue names, and the replay procedure are documented on the internal page below.

runbook for tahog-kadug: https://gitlab.qirvanworks.corp/projects/pages/view/b139298aed28